For our autofocus lab test, we shoot 30 consecutive exposures and defocus the device between each shot, and then wait either a short (500ms) or long (2000ms) delay before requesting focus during our benchmark lab tests. Overall, the Xiaomi Mi 9 isn’t one of the top-performing devices for night photography under our new testing protocol, but achieves pretty good results with the flash forced on, showing good exposure with very little vignetting, excellent repeatability, well-controlled noise levels, and fairly accurate white balance when shooting both with flash-only or when using the flash with 5 lux of ambient tungsten illumination.
